Shots fired at Dodge Charger on 14th St SE in Cedar Rapids, passenger treated for minor injuries
The Gazette
Dec. 29, 2018 7:38 pm
On December 29 around 4:38 p.m., the Cedar Rapids Police Department reportedly responded to Mercy Medical Center for a subject who claims he was shot at. The report states the subject was driving a rented Dodge Charter on 14th St SE in the 500-700 block of Cedar Rapids when the car was shot at and hit three times.
According to the report, there were no injuries from gunshots, but Mercy Medical Center staff treated the passenger for injuries from glass fragments. The driver and front passenger were reportedly the car's only occupants, and no other injuries were reported.
According to Cedar Rapids Police, no arrests have been made.
